Output 8b70f6fcfe42c8c93c128b1411dbed3cd0124ba1eabce22aeb539c07636cb856:1

value
17145340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dec13d5f539f450a8e92fbe9c0fcc31a7f37e56 OP_EQUAL
address
3G62pcTr7GGjpacUaJjcsaG7DiJ85MdCfb
transaction
8b70f6fcfe42c8c93c128b1411dbed3cd0124ba1eabce22aeb539c07636cb856
spent
true